Right of way at intersections: CoSpaces Edu
Exercise in CoSpaces Edu simulating through code the right-of-way rules at an intersection and an intersection with traffic lights. Afterwards, students code a simulation of city traffic in 3D.

Rollercoaster in 3D: CoSpaces Edu
Thanks to CoSpaces Edu you can build a roller coaster in 3D. Bring your amusement park ride to life using animations and code blocks.

Build your first 3D world with CoSpaces Edu
CoSpaces Edu is a 3D platform for education. With speech and animations you can bring a self-built 3D world to life.

VEXcode VR: Online STEM platform for 8+
VEXcode VR is an easy-to-use platform that allows you to program a virtual robot using a block-based programming environment powered by Scratch or with a specially developed Python interface.
